Dating Confidence Reset
Start by clarifying what you want. Decide whether you’re looking for casual conversation, new friends, or something long-term, and write down one or two realistic outcomes you’d accept from a first month of using Mingle2. Having a short list of priorities keeps you from chasing every match and helps you recognize progress.
Pace conversations intentionally. Aim for steady, two-way interaction rather than instant chemistry. Give new chats a few thoughtful messages over several days before moving to a phone call or date. That slower rhythm reveals consistency and reduces the stress of trying to impress in every message.
Set healthy expectations. Expect some mismatches and quiet periods. Treat each chat as information: you learn about another person and about what matters to you. That mindset makes rejection feel less personal and helps you avoid the numbers-game trap where quantity replaces quality.
Keep emotional steadiness with simple habits. Limit app time to specific windows, take breaks after a draining interaction, and keep at least one offline priority—exercise, work, or a hobby—that restores perspective. Small routines protect your confidence and stop dating from overwhelming you.
Notice small wins. Celebrate clear communication, a respectful message, or a conversation that taught you something. Tracking these wins reminds you that dating is progress, not only endpoints.
Choose matches more thoughtfully. Use your priorities to filter messages quickly: scan profiles for deal-breakers, common interests, or conversation starters, and move on when someone doesn’t align. It’s kinder to both people to invest where there’s mutual interest.
Finally, be kind to yourself. Confidence grows from consistent choices—clear goals, steady pacing, realistic expectations, and small daily practices—that make online dating feel manageable and respectful of your time and energy.
